Both Mukesh Ambani-led Reliance Industries (RIL) and Gautam Adani-led Adani Total Gas (ATGL) have announced intentions to build 10 compressed biogas (CBG) facilities apiece across India.
These facilities will be able to produce up to 30 million tonnes annually. For the construction of these plants, the corporations will each invest up to INR 2500 crore.
The locations of the plants have already been chosen by RIL and ATGL. Five plants will be built during the course of the next five years, while the remaining units will be operational at a later date.
Five CBG facilities will be built by RIL in Gujarat, and the remaining five would be spread out across the nation.
Currently, there is an ongoing development of a plant in Uttar Pradesh with a daily capacity of 600 tonnes, expected to commence CBG production by the end of the current financial year.
